如何做好SQL质量监控
SLS推出用户级SQL质量监控功能,集成于CloudLens for SLS,提供健康分、服务指标、运行明细、SQL Pattern分析及优化建议五大维度,帮助用户全面掌握SQL使用情况,识别异常、优化性能,提升日志分析效率与资源管理能力。
Day01-MybatisPlus讲义
本项目基于若依框架与AI技术,开发“中州养老”管理系统。面对中国老龄化趋势及智慧养老产业的快速发展(2023年市场规模12万亿元,预计2027年达21.1万亿元),项目旨在为养老院提供涵盖来访、入退住、服务、财务等全流程管理的软件解决方案。系统分为管理后台和家属端,采用Vue3+Element Plus、SpringBoot、MyBatis-Plus等主流技术栈,并集成Redis、Nginx
二、Hive安装部署详细过程
手把手教你完成 Hive 的安装、配置和可视化连接,适合初学者快速搭建自己的大数据分析平台。内容涵盖从环境准备、Metastore配置,到 DataGrip 连接的全流程,并附带实用的排错指南,助你轻松迈出 Hive 入门第一步。
线程池:故障梳理总结
本文从故障与技术双重视角,总结线程池满导致服务不可用的常见成因及应对策略。涵盖数据库慢查询、热更新、DDL锁表、连接池配置不当等典型故障,并深入分析Dubbo、Http、Druid、Redis等连接池的超时控制与隔离设计。强调fast-fail理念、合理设置超时时间、流控背压与谨慎重试,助力开发者提升系统稳定性,避免线上事故。
安全体系:如何建立可靠的安全体系?
RPC安全聚焦于内网环境下的服务调用可控性,重点解决未授权调用与假冒服务提供者问题。通过为调用方颁发唯一身份,并在服务端完成鉴权,可有效防止非法接入;结合注册中心对接口与应用绑定,防止接口被恶意冒用。虽处内网,仍需建立轻量、可靠的安全体系,保障系统稳定。
异步 RPC:压榨单机吞吐量
本文探讨如何通过异步优化提升RPC单机吞吐量。核心在于解决业务逻辑耗时导致CPU利用率低的问题,关键策略是实现调用端与服务端的全异步化。通过Future、Callback及CompletableFuture等机制,减少线程等待,提升并发处理能力。尤其推荐使用Java8原生支持的CompletableFuture,实现无侵入、高效的全链路异步,显著提高系统吞吐量。
线程池单例模式实现
本文详解Java中单例线程池的设计与实现,剖析静态内部类、双重检查锁和Spring Bean三种生产级方案,解决资源浪费、管控混乱等问题,提升系统并发性能与稳定性。